Illustrating Landscapes in Flat Design: A Beginner's Guide
Embarking on the journey of drawing landscapes in flat design can be an rewarding endeavor. This creative style, characterized by its simplified shapes and bold colors, provides a unique opportunity to capture the essence of nature without getting overwhelmed by intricate details.
- Begin by selecting your landscape {subject|. For instance, you could depict a serene mountain range, a bustling cityscape, or a tranquil forest scene.
- Visualize the overall mood and atmosphere you want to convey. Do you aim for a vibrant and energetic scene, or a calm and peaceful one? Your color choices and composition will play a crucial role in setting the appropriate ambiance.
- Streamline complex elements into basic shapes. Mountains can become geometric forms, trees might be represented by stylized lines, and water can be a flat expanse of blue or green.
Play around with bold colors and contrasts. Flat design often utilizes vibrant hues to build visual impact. Don't hesitate from using bright colors even in unexpected combinations.
